How to join WIZARD

WIZARD welcomes researchers working on methods of data science, machine learning, and AI. Prospective members contact a Centre Council member (or deputy) whose research best matches their own; that Council member sponsors the application to the Council. Admission is decided by simple majority of the Centre Council. Membership is secondary to your home faculty/institute and carries the usual participation rights (full voting rights for members; advisory participation for associate members).

Quick steps

Full Members (UOL academics)

  1. Check eligibility (UOL academic: professor/retired professor or research staff in an advanced academic position).
  2. Identify a Centre Council member/deputy aligned with your field and email them a short CV + 5–10 keywords of methods/areas.
  3. Your sponsor submits your application to the Centre Council.
  4. The Council votes (simple majority). You receive confirmation.

Associate Members (non-UOL scientists, incl. affiliated institutes/industry)

  1. Contact a Council member/deputy aligned with your field (send short CV + 5–10 keywords).
  2. Your sponsor brings the application to the Centre Council.
  3. The Council votes (simple majority). You receive confirmation (associate members participate in an advisory capacity).
